Fort Bend Marshall and Iowa Colony squared off in some playoff action on Friday, but Fort Bend Marshall had to settle for second. They took a 31-21 hit to the loss column at the hands of the Iowa Colony Pioneers. The Buffalos' loss signaled the end of their four-game winning streak.
Carson White was his usual excellent self, rushing for 125 yards and two touchdowns, while also throwing for 101 yards and a touchdown for Iowa Colony. The dominant performance gave White a new career-high in rushing yards.
Fort Bend Marshall's defeat dropped their record down to 10-3. As for Iowa Colony, the win (which was their eighth in a row) raised their record to 12-1.
Fort Bend Marshall does not have any more games scheduled as of now. As for Iowa Colony, they will take on Randle at 6:00 p.m. on Saturday. Both have allowed few points on average, (Randle: 6.6, Iowa Colony: 12.7) so any points scored will be well earned.
